Specializes in meeting the needs of low-income, non-English and limited-English speaking Asian and Pacific-Islander individuals and families who have difficulty accessing resources and assistance due to language, cultural or geographic barriers. Clients must be 16 and older or accompanied by a parent or legal guardian. Serves King County residents or those who have a case filed in King County. Can potentially serve out-of-state clients by phone when the client has no alternative.
Appointments occur Tues, 5:30-7:30pm. Appointment scheduling occurs during regular CISC business hours

Chinese Information and Service Center, Asian Bar Association of Washington, and Asian Counseling and Referral Service partner with the King County Bar Association to provide a free legal clinic. Pro bono attorneys work with staff and volunteer interpreters to give consultation and legal advice around family law, immigration law, landlord-tenant disputes, employment law, and other areas. As of 9/2024, most consults are virtual but in-person appointments may be available if needed (more information provided to clients during intake phone call). Call (206) 957-8544 for an appointment.
